Output 8f502ae31787185d2eb46a603f2074b489ce223d4488807aa3250d41e23d0051:2

value
42222695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5980fa53af47378cca3391afe340760ac44c25f OP_EQUAL
address
MUq98kW6e3mh3dtnemBboBTLDB7YccZTur
transaction
8f502ae31787185d2eb46a603f2074b489ce223d4488807aa3250d41e23d0051
spent
true